Crauchie Farmhouse, East Linton, East Lothian

A picture-book Georgian farmhouse hidden up a winding lane in the midst of fields and woods yet only minutes from the pubs, shops and sights of East Linton, a village beloved by artists for centuries. All the peace and quiet of the countryside with the culture and beauty of Edinburgh only 40 minutes drive away – or take the train or bus to avoid city parking nightmares.
Ground Floor: 1 double room with a king-size bed.
The bathroom is ensuite with bath, cabinet power-shower, WC and hand-basin.
There are views over the garden, a TV with DVD player and a tea and coffee tray.
First floor: 1 room with twin beds, which can ‘zip and link’ to become a large double.
The private bathroom is right next door (one step away) and has a bath with hand shower, WC and hand basin.
This room has views over the fields and hills, TV with extra freeview channels and a tea and coffee tray.
All rooms have wireless internet access.
Breakfast: This is served in the pretty dining room, overlooking the hills and fields.
Joanna offers home-prepared fruit salads and compôtes, cereals and fruit juice and her own special blend of porridge, followed by a freshly-cooked Scottish breakfast of egg, bacon, sausage, black pudding, tomato, mushroom and fried potato, or the combination of your choice. Tea, coffee or chocolate accompanied by hot toast and marmalade or jam complete the meal.
The freshest of eggs come from the local farm shop, where the hens scratch in outside runs, the bacon and sausages are the village butcher’s own make and the award-winning black pudding is from Stornoway – not local but very much worth the trip!
Vegetarian and other special diets can be catered for and packed lunches provided with adequate notice.
Guests are welcome to use the terrace and walled garden. There is plenty of parking space in the gravelled drive.
